What are the typical daily responsibilities of a Revizto Specialist in a construction or design team?

A Revizto Specialist is primarily responsible for managing project collaboration using the Revizto platform, which includes setting up and maintaining project models, facilitating clash detection, and coordinating issue tracking among team members. Daily tasks often involve importing BIM models, updating project data, hosting coordination meetings, and supporting team members in using Revizto effectively. The role requires close collaboration with architects, engineers, and contractors to ensure everyone is working with the most up-to-date information, helping to streamline workflows and reduce errors throughout the project lifecycle.

What does Revizto do?

Revizto is a software platform used in the architecture, engineering, and construction industries to facilitate collaboration and coordination on building projects. It integrates 3D models, issue tracking, and communication tools to improve project efficiency and reduce errors. Professionals working with Revizto often need skills in BIM, CAD, or project management tools.

What is a Revizto Specialist?

A Revizto Specialist is a professional who uses Revizto, a cloud-based collaboration platform, to manage and coordinate Building Information Modeling (BIM) projects. They are responsible for integrating and reviewing 3D models, facilitating issue tracking, and streamlining communication among project stakeholders in the architecture, engineering, and construction (AEC) industries. Their expertise ensures that projects remain on track, with improved coordination and reduced errors, by leveraging Revizto’s real-time collaboration tools.

VDC Coordinator

Would you like to be part of a company that is employee owned? If so, I invite you to consider joining NOOTER, the largest regional provider of mechanical and electrical contracting services, in the Toledo, Ohio area.

NOOTER is seeking experienced VDC Coordinators to join our Virtual Design and Construction team to work on projects in the Industrial and Manufacturing sectors. This position would support our project execution team at various job sites regionally.

This role involves developing detailed and accurate 3D models using Revit and Navisworks. Additionally, the VDC Coordinator would be responsible for producing coordinated 3D models, integrating with various trades, collaborating and supporting project managers, engineers and field teams with accurate construction documents. The successful candidate would be proficient in Trimble, Bluebeam, Revizto, Revit, Navisworks, AutoCAD, MEP and other related modeling software.

Primary responsibilities include, but are not limited to:

  • Review piping and/or electrical 3D models using Revit and NavisWorks or Revizto as well as other design software.
  • Assist site team with 3D coordination and clash detection using Revizto or Navisworks.
  • Prepare installation drawings for equipment, piping and cable tray to be used with our Robotic Instruments and coordinate with or assist the site layout team.
  • Use 3D scanning tools for verification and as-built drawings and process the scans.
  • Manage coordination models, model-based submittals and shop drawings. Assess conformance to contract specifications. Resolve any conflicts in design intent/interpretation.
  • Communicate with Project Engineers/Project Manager and assist the project team by providing the needed information for construction.
